Day: November 30, 2021

  • Home
  • November 30, 2021

How do Shop Front Roller Shutter help your Business Safety?

How Does Shop Front Roller Shutter in London Help Your Business? Shop front shutters in London are essential to every business nowadays, you’d barely find any retail shop without one. As the concerns for security rise, so does the need for security measures, and one such